Code pour chandelier japonais

Viewing 15 posts - 1 through 15 (of 24 total)
  • Author
    Posts
  • #5524 quote
    Yannick
    Participant
    Veteran

    Bonjour à tous

    J’ai decouvert le site qui est super et je suis à la recherche de code ou d’un indicateur pour détecter les chandelier japonais

    Dans pro screener, il est possible de scanner les marchés

    https://www.prorealtime.com/en/help-manual/candlesticks-detection

    Mais je souhaiterais faire tourner une stratégie  fonctionnant sur le principe de détection chandelier japonais de retournement (marteau, marabozu,harami…) + oscillateur en survente/surchat (RSI, stochastique,…).

     

    Est ce que quelqu’un sait comment faire pour la détection de chandelier japonais?

    Merci

    #5573 quote
    Nicolas
    Keymaster
    Master

    Bonjour Yannick, merci pour tes compliments.

    En effet, il serait sympa de se créer une bibliothèque de code pour la détection des figures de chandelier japonais. C’est une très bonne idée.

    En gros ça consiste “simplement” à tester les OHLC de chaque chandelier et également les ratios des ombres vis à vis des corps des bougies.

    • SI (high-close)>1.5*(close-open) ALORS figure chandelier X

    etc..

    #5574 quote
    Doctrading
    Participant
    Master

    Bonjour,

    C’est faisable et facile.

    J’ai déjà posté un code sur le “harami” et les “3 corbeaux / soldats”, l’avancement haussier est aussi simple, l’étoile du matin est faisable, etc.

    Après, à chacun de paramétrer (différence de taille entre les bougies, etc.).
    Ce qui est plus dur à programmer est de mettre par exemple “étoile du matin au niveau d’un support / en pleine phase baissière”.
    La phase baissière peut être définie par des moyennes mobiles, tout simplement.

     

    Il existe déjà une bibliothèque d’indicateurs, il y en a quelques uns sympas.

    #5595 quote
    Davex770
    Participant
    Average

    hi yanick

    comme nicolas a preceder- la detection de figures de chandeliers japonais et baser sur une idee trop simple a realiser: les cours douverture  cloture plus haut et plus bas. se qui et connue comme OHLC  et q dailleur font partie des notions de base de le language de programation dans nimporte quel platforme danalyse technique sur le marchee.  plusieurs figures existe dailleur deja dans la biblioteque de prorealtime. dautre dans des fichiers privee et dailleurs notre amie du forum docteurtrading en a mis en ligne plusieurs -si je ne me trompe pas les trois soldats blanc etc

    ceci  dit ilya deux points importants q je trouve a souligner:

    1. les chandeliers japonais eux meme seulement ne sont pas sufisament puissant pour emetre des signaux de trading avec succes.  on peut biensur trouver des configurations connue plus ou moin qui on renverser une tendance avec succes  mes dans dautre ocasion qui ont echouer.  lauteur thomas bulkowsky dailleur a ecrit un livre avec toutes les figures de renversement de tendance acompagner de leur taux de reussite statistique et le moins q on puis dire et q la conclusion et q aucune figure peut vraiment sur le long terme ammener un taux de reussite sufisament favorable surtout contre le risuqe acompagner.
    2. ceci dis- javes pris touts les exemple de bulkowski et je les et analyser sur duex configurations donnee ( ingolfing et piercing): du moment ou on aplique certain filtre baser sur dautre methode ou indicateurs simple: le taux de reussite augement dune facon spectaculaire: des dizaine de faux signaux sont eliminer.
    3. donc avant tous: une librarie de figures chandelier sera untile uniquement comme composant dun indicateur ou strategy plus complex qui en effet comme ta demande: sera accompagner de second indicateur ou graphique/
    4. une idee tres simple et accesible: le livre de stevan bigalow explique le travail simple de chaque figure avec lacompagenement de lindicater de stochastique. sela suffira pour te donnee une idee simple et facile a realiser sur prorealtime.
    5. encore plus important: les chandeliers sont execelent pour le timing me ne sont pas la pourles targets et objectif. car si en tamp q target tu atendera une figure de renversement au sense invers: la plupart de tes gains seront jeter a la poubelless…
    6. en fin: les chandeliers japonais sont un language qui et puissnt uniquement avec precisions. plusieurs indicateur de detection de chandelier sur le marchee icompris pour prorealtime sont codee et donc interpreter dune facon erronee.  donc atention: la precision ici et crucial.
    7. je met cree ilya longtamp une petit librarie de figures q je nutilise plus je v eseyer de la retrouver et la uplaoder pour les interessers.
    8. good luck
    #5604 quote
    Yannick
    Participant
    Veteran

    Bonjour

    merci de vos réponses.

    en parallèle j ai contacté le service support de prorealtime. Dans l attente d une réponse.

    Merci à davex pour son français.

    Mon idee est de combiner chandelier japonais et oscillateur stochastique pour déclencher une vente ou achat. Puis trailing stop ou clôture de position sur oscillateur qui va dans le sens opposé.

    Je trouve facilement dans l assitant de MT5 les figures préprogrammées mais je ne trouve pas celle directement sous PRT.

    Je vais donc lire avec interet votre référence de Steven Bigalow.

    #5613 quote
    Davex770
    Participant
    Average

    yanick

    tu na rien inventer dans se domaine-il existe des centaines de system se basent sur le declenchement de figure chandeliers en paralele avec un indicateur technique ou autre outils. certain tienne la routte   dautre pas dutout. je rajoute sela pour bien souligner q le processus de developement afin darriver a un resultat qui permet de lesser son system travailler pour lui nes pas aussi court et ne se limit pas seulement au parametre q tu vien de mentioner.

    une figure de chandelier ammenne une possibilitee dentree en position en matiere de timing.  loscilateur filtre plus ou moins les faux siganux…ok

    MAIS !!  apres tous sela ou doit je fixer mon stop initiale? question numero un. sa depend de bcp de parametre qui inclut la volatilitee. la situation du signal. les support ou resistance entourant le signal et malheureusement se domain et large trop pour le definir depuis un ou de parametre adaptatif. un stop se basent sur la configuration chandelier elle meme sera sur un backtest long dangereuse qui te fera ejecter souvant just avant davancer directement vere ton objectif. si jamais tu decide de leloigner davantage- les trades perdant seront plus ample defois du total de tes objectif reel. etc etc.

    et sela meme avant de parler de levolution du trade jusqua ton objectif etc etc

     

    donc ton idee et belle et bien une base uniquement de timing sur laquel il faudera q tu evolue et avance en cherchent/

    le plus dans tous sela et effectivement la facilitee de programer tous ces idee rapidement sur prorealtime. en fette- detection de figure chandelier en combinant un oscilateur comme preciser dans ton message et une mission facile a mort dans prorealtime la ou tu na pas besoin meme pas de declarer les variable

    good luck

    #5712 quote
    Yannick
    Participant
    Veteran

    Bonjour

    J’ai trouvé dans la bibliothèque des indicateurs

    https://www.prorealtime.com/fr/bibliotheque-d-indicateurs

    https://www.prorealtime.com/en/indicator-library

    Les chandeliers en question.

    A suivre

    #8236 quote
    Yannick
    Participant
    Veteran

    Merci de votre aide

    ci joint code

    retourne +1 bullish/-1 bearish

    Par contre je n’arrive pas a trouver de code interessant  oscillateur + chandelier qui soit gagnant

    structure=0
    BearishEngulfing = close[1]>open[1] AND open>close[1] AND close<open[1] AND close<open
    IF BearishEngulfing THEN
    structure=-1
    Endif
    
    HaramiBaisse = close[1]>open[1] AND open<close[1] AND close>open[1] AND close<open
    
    IF HaramiBaisse THEN
    structure=-1
    ENDIF
    
    HaramiHausse = close[1]<open[1] AND open>close[1] AND close<open[1] AND open<close
    IF HaramiHausse THEN
    structure=1
    ENDIF
    BullishEngulfing = close[1]<open[1] AND open<close[1] AND close>open[1] AND close>open
    
    IF BullishEngulfing THEN
    structure=1
    
    Endif
    
    
    RETURN structure
    
    Chandelier-bullish-bearish.itf
    #8256 quote
    Katia_Paris_75
    Participant
    Average

    Bonjour,

    je suis très intéressée par le code du chandelier japonais appelé “Marteau” qui est très souvent une figure de renversement.

    Si vous pouvez également fournir le proscreener qui permet de détecter ensuite les marteaux dans une liste de valeurs, ce serait top !

    Merci par avance à vous

    Katia

    #8281 quote
    Yannick
    Participant
    Veteran

    Bonjour

    Voir le lien

    https://www.prorealtime.com/en/indicator-library-open-837

    je vais rajouter le doji et le marteau à l’indicteur et le proposer dans blbliothèque

    #8286 quote
    Nicolas
    Keymaster
    Master

    Bonjour, chacun peut partager ses indicateurs et autres programmes dans la “library” du site, je me ferai un plaisir de les ajouter, c’est fait pour ça 🙂

    #8666 quote
    Doctrading
    Participant
    Master

    Bonjour,

    Est-ce que quelqu’un est encore intéressé par un code “pin bar” (marteau et étoile filante) ?

    J’en ai déjà un codé personnellement, je peux le mettre en librairie.
    A bientôt

    #8667 quote
    Doctrading
    Participant
    Master
    #8669 quote
    Nicolas
    Keymaster
    Master

    J’ai incorporé plusieurs figures dans une stratégie récemment, hormis les plus courantes, voici celles construites sur 3 chandeliers

    Morning Star (étoile du matin):

    //morning star
    atrDoji = 5
    atrLongue = 2
    c11 = (Close[2] < Open[2]) AND (ABS(Close[2] - Open[2]) > AverageTrueRange[14](Close[2])/atrLongue)
    c12 = c11 AND (ABS(Close[1] - Open[1]) < AverageTrueRange[14](Close[1])/atrDoji) AND Open[1] <= Close[2]
    MORNINGSTAR = c12 AND (Close > Open) AND (ABS(Close - Open) > AverageTrueRange[14](Close)/atrLongue) AND (Close >= Open[2])


    Evening Star (étoile du soir):

    //evening star
    atrDoji = 5
    atrLongue = 2
    c13 = (Close[2] > Open[2]) AND (ABS(Close[2] - Open[2]) > AverageTrueRange[14](Close[2])/atrLongue)
    c14 = c13 AND (ABS(Close[1] - Open[1]) < AverageTrueRange[14](Close[1])/atrDoji) AND Open[1] >= Close[2]
    EVENINGSTAR = c14 AND (Close < Open) AND (ABS(Close - Open) > AverageTrueRange[14](Close)/atrLongue) AND (Close <= Open[2])
    #8681 quote
    Doctrading
    Participant
    Master

    Sympa.

    Le tout sera de tenter de combiner ces figures avec par exemple des oscillateurs.
    Mais rien ne remplacera le “visuel”, avec les supports / résistances, etc.

    Ca peut être faisable mais très long à programmer.

Viewing 15 posts - 1 through 15 (of 24 total)
  • You must be logged in to reply to this topic.

Code pour chandelier japonais


ProBuilder : Indicateurs & Outils Personnalisés

New Reply
Author
author-avatar
Yannick @yannick Participant
Summary

This topic contains 23 replies,
has 2 voices, and was last updated by netskiss
4 years, 9 months ago.

Topic Details
Forum: ProBuilder : Indicateurs & Outils Personnalisés
Language: French
Started: 04/17/2016
Status: Active
Attachments: 1 files
Logo Logo
Loading...